A Practice Note addressing the key issues organizations, individuals, and their counsel must consider in complying with their legal duty to produce electronically stored information (ESI) in litigation. This Note specifically addresses parties' and non-parties' ESI preservation and production obligations and the consequences of failing to meet those duties.
